Setting Limits: Responsible Gambling at Non‑GamStop Sites

Setting Limits: Responsible Gambling at Non‑GamStop Sites

Why the Problem Exists

Look: the moment a player lands on a non‑GamStop casino, the safety net snaps. No central blacklist, no automatic block. The thrill spikes, the wallet thins, and the line between fun and compulsion blurs. People think “I’m in control.” Reality bites fast. That gap is where addiction hides, and it’s wide open for anyone who doesn’t set a personal fence.

Self‑Imposed Boundaries, Not Fancy Filters

Here is the deal: you cannot rely on external tools; you become the firewall. First, set a hard budget. Write the figure on a sticky note, tape it to the monitor, and never exceed it. Second, impose a time cap. Eight minutes, thirty minutes—pick a slice and stick to it. Third, recognize the “chasing” reflex. Stop chasing losses, or you’ll spin into a black hole of endless bets.

Bankroll Management Hacks

By the way, the classic 5‑percent rule works wonders. If your bankroll is $1,000, never stake more than $50 in a session. It forces discipline, shrinks the impulse to go all‑in, and keeps the fun level steady. Mix in a “stop‑loss” threshold—once you lose $200, shut the tab. No excuses. Even a modest loss can trigger a shutdown, preventing the runaway train.

Time‑Tracking Tricks

And here is why a simple kitchen timer beats any fancy app. Set it for 15 minutes, play, then pause. The break forces a reality check. You’ll often find the urge evaporates, replaced by a rational thought: “Do I really want to keep rolling?” The brain loves a forced pause; it disrupts the dopamine loop.

Psychology of the Non‑GamStop Environment

Non‑GamStop sites lure with “no limits,” promising freedom. That phrase is a double‑edged sword. Freedom feels like liberty, but it also removes the guardrails that keep you from falling. The lack of a mandatory self‑exclusion notice breeds a false confidence. Players think, “I’m safe; I’m not on a blacklist.” Yet the same freedom can become a trap if you don’t self‑regulate.

Emotional Checkpoints

When you feel a surge—heart racing, palms sweaty—recognize it as a signal, not a cue to bet. The body is whispering “caution.” Ignoring it is like ignoring a smoke alarm. Pause, breathe, ask yourself: “Am I chasing excitement or chasing loss?” Answer honestly, then act accordingly.

Tools You Can Build Yourself

Every player can craft a personal “stop‑page.” Open a new browser tab titled “Limit Reached.” When the budget or time limit hits, switch to that tab and stay. It feels like a wall, but it’s your own—no external system needed. Also, use spreadsheet tracking. Log every deposit, loss, win. Seeing the numbers on paper can break the illusion of endless credit.

Community Accountability

Even in a solo game, you can enlist a buddy. Text a friend before you start: “I have $300 budget, 60 minutes.” Ask them to check in after the session. The external nudge adds pressure to stick to the plan. Peer pressure, in this case, is a good thing.

Final Actionable Advice

Set a firm budget, slap a timer on your screen, and log every move. When the limit hits, close the tab, walk away, and never look back.
